    She warmed under his gaze. She liked the feeling his countenance gave off. His Aura her mother would call it. Gentle yet burning like the auburn of his coat. Quite waters run deep another contribution from her mothers bank of sayings. She was more like The Storyteller, her dam, than she would admit. But today was not a day for reflection. She had a feeling today would be a day that fed reflection, later. Today Tangerine was writing her own story, today was the first chapter. Everything before now was prologue.  

    The elation from her new found independence cast a golden glow on all she saw today. Even the grasses seemed to smell sweeter here. But then she saw something which put a question in her round amber eyes. There in Warrick's eyes she caught a flicker, like a small quick flame. Not even a fully formed flame, just a spark. There! Then it's gone. But in a dry forest a spark is all that's needed. One spark in an ancient bed of nettles can light an entire woodland. She tucks away that look in her mind. The softening of his focus, a slight tightening in his brow. It was a memory she saw there... and it didn't look like a happy one. It wouldn't do to address such a thing now, and anyway she doesn't have time even if she wanted to. 

    His focus was pulled away from her. A flutter, a thump, as four light hooves connected with the earth. Mimicking his move she looked toward the new arrival who mysteriously came without the heraldry of approaching hoof beats. Her breath caught, her heart jumped. In front of them stood a winged creature. Up close, the massive birds feathers of the girls wings were fascinating. Of course Tang had seen many feathers as she played in the grasses of home, they had always been a novelty to investigate. But to see such feathers as these! Feathers longer than her tail the details and shimmer momentarily mesmerized her. She had seen these winged horses floating in the sky during her journey, lazily drifting on thermals or blazing like comets, covering miles faster than the fastest hooves could manage. But so close, her wonder was fresh.  She had assumed they were a separate race, nobility or deity. The stranger spoke in a casual and relaxed manor, she smiled. Tang reflected the youthful smile back to her. 

    The stallion spoke in his calm way and she looked back to him pointedly, trying to take a cue on how to interact with such a creature as this winged filly. To her surprise he seemed completely unfazed. Apparently she had a lot to learn. 

    A place for everyone he said. Is that what she wanted, a place? She didn't think so. Her gaze was drawn back to Bristol. She addressed the two of them in general. Well you two know these lands much better than I! I have no particular place I'm going. Although, I would like to find a home  for winter. But I'm not looking for a place to grow roots. She wondered how tightly these territories they spoke of were controlled, patrolled, regulated. She hadn't thought of that. What if she trespassed? She may be young but she knew not all the horses she would meet on this journey would be as welcoming as these two.  
    Her eyes watched the novel filly, but she kept one ear on Warrick.
